Abstract

This paper explores some new, important and interesting connections between Multiple-Objective Programming (MOP) and Data Envelopment Analysis (DEA). We show that imposing weight restrictions in DEA corresponds to changing the ordering cone in MOP in a specific way. The new ordering cone is constructed and its properties are proved, providing useful insights about the connections between MOP and DEA. After providing several theoretical results, we illustrate them on a real-world data set. In addition to their theoretical appeal, our results hold significant practical importance for several reasons which are addressed in the paper.
